DaVinci Resolve Studio relies heavily on deep hardware integration with your GPU and CPU. "Fixed" or cracked versions alter the software's core binary code to bypass activation checks. This modification frequently breaks background processes, leading to: Sudden crashes during heavy rendering tasks. Corrupted project files and lost timelines.

The allure of a free and fixed DaVinci Resolve Studio 20 license key is understandable, given the software's capabilities and the cost associated with its professional version. However, the risks and downsides of pursuing unauthorized license keys far outweigh any perceived benefits. By choosing legitimate paths, such as purchasing a license or utilizing the free version, users can enjoy a stable, secure, and fully supported experience with DaVinci Resolve. In the world of digital content creation, it's essential to prioritize both creativity and integrity, ensuring that professional tools are used responsibly and within the bounds of the law.
